Size and Proportion

Because a console table should feel like a subtle extension of the wall, aim for a length that’s 75–85 % of the wall it sits against—for example, a 40‑inch table pairs nicely with a 50‑inch wall without dominating the space. Keep depth between 8 in. and 12 in. to stay flush with a sofa seat while still allowing airflow and legroom. Match height to the sofa seat (≈ 29 in. – 33 in.) so the line stays unified. In a narrow hallway, limit width to no more than 40 in., otherwise you’ll block traffic and feel cramped. Always leave at least 4 in. of clearance from walls or other furniture for a relaxed, functional layout. Make sure you measure the space beforehand so you can visualize how the table fits into your room layout.

Space and Layout

If you’re planning a cozy yet functional entryway, aligning your loveseat’s dimensions with your hallway’s real estate is essential. First, measure your hallway width. A loveseat spans 68‑80 inches, so set aside at least 90 inches of clear floor space to keep traffic easy. Seat depth sits 21‑25 inches; add 8‑12 inches behind the sofa for footrests or easy passage. Check doorways: 32‑36 inches wide will allow most loveseat‑console combos to slide through without disassembly. When the console reclines, depth can reach 35‑40 inches; carve an extra 4‑6 inches of wall clearance for a relaxed cluster. Finally, if your ceiling is under eight feet, a fully reclined loveseat—41‑45 inches high—will hit the overhead; verify clearance or pick a shallower model right away now.
